引言
渲染是计算机图形学中一个至关重要的环节,它负责将三维场景转换为二维图像。WYG(What You Get)渲染技术作为一种新兴的渲染方法,因其高效性和灵活性受到了广泛关注。本文将深入探讨wyg渲染的原理、技术要点以及在实际应用中的使用方法,帮助读者从入门到精通,全面解读渲染教材精华。
第一章:wyg渲染概述
1.1 wyg渲染的定义
wyg渲染,即“所见即所得”渲染,是一种基于光线追踪和物理渲染的实时渲染技术。它通过模拟真实世界中的光线传播规律,实现场景的真实感渲染。
1.2 wyg渲染的特点
- 实时性:wyg渲染能够在短时间内完成渲染,满足实时交互的需求。
- 真实感:通过模拟真实光线传播,实现场景的真实感渲染。
- 灵活性:支持多种渲染效果,如阴影、反射、折射等。
第二章:wyg渲染原理
2.1 光线追踪
光线追踪是wyg渲染的核心技术之一,它通过模拟光线在场景中的传播过程,计算出场景中每个像素的颜色。
2.2 物理渲染
物理渲染是基于真实世界物理规律的渲染方法,它能够模拟光线、阴影、反射、折射等现象。
2.3 渲染管线
渲染管线是wyg渲染过程中的数据处理流程,包括几何处理、着色、光照、合成等环节。
第三章:wyg渲染技术要点
3.1 场景建模
场景建模是wyg渲染的基础,它包括三维模型的创建、材质设置等。
3.2 光照模型
光照模型是wyg渲染中模拟光线传播的重要环节,包括点光源、聚光源、面光源等。
3.3 阴影处理
阴影处理是wyg渲染中实现场景真实感的关键,包括软阴影、硬阴影等。
3.4 反射与折射
反射与折射是模拟真实世界光线传播的重要环节,包括镜面反射、漫反射、折射等。
第四章:wyg渲染应用实例
4.1 游戏开发
wyg渲染在游戏开发中的应用非常广泛,如Unity、Unreal Engine等游戏引擎都支持wyg渲染。
4.2 虚拟现实
wyg渲染在虚拟现实中的应用,如VR游戏、VR教育等。
4.3 建筑可视化
wyg渲染在建筑可视化中的应用,如室内设计、室外景观等。
第五章:wyg渲染未来发展趋势
5.1 高性能计算
随着计算机性能的提升,wyg渲染将更加高效、实时。
5.2 新型渲染技术
新型渲染技术,如基于深度学习的渲染、基于光线追踪的渲染等,将进一步提升wyg渲染的真实感。
5.3 跨平台应用
wyg渲染将在更多平台上得到应用,如移动设备、智能穿戴设备等。
结语
wyg渲染作为一种新兴的渲染技术,具有广泛的应用前景。本文从入门到精通,全面解读了渲染教材精华,希望对读者有所帮助。随着技术的不断发展,wyg渲染将在未来发挥更加重要的作用。
